From: A thermodynamic potential for barium zirconate titanate solid solutions

Fig. 6

Piezoelectric coefficients a d15, and b d33 of Ba(ZrxTi1−x)O3 solid solutions as a function of composition x and temperature. The phase transition temperature lines are also marked. c the piezoelectric coefficient as a function of composition x at room temperature, the experimental data of d33 denoted by squares (single crystals)20,55,66,67 and circles (ceramics).17,22 d d15 and e d33 as a function of composition x and electric field (E along [001] direction) at room temperature, and f the corresponding piezoelectric coefficients for the case x = 0.225
